Anzac Sunday
The New Plymouth Chamber of Commerce thinks Anzac commemoration services should be held on the last Sunday in April, the day to be known as Anzac Sunday. The Associated Chambers have sought opinions on the subject. “Anzac Day is a joke now,” said Mr J. S. Crighton. “I don’t know why they still call it Anzac Day—it is a remembrance day of any war.”
